      <title>Finnlines Reopens the Passenger Route to Poland</title>
      <link>http://www.finnlines.com/index.php/passenger_eng/current_issues/finnlines_reopens_the_passenger_route_to_poland</link>
      <guid>http://www.finnlines.com/index.php/passenger_eng/current_issues/finnlines_reopens_the_passenger_route_to_poland</guid>
      <description>&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;Ten weekly departures on the Travemünde-Helsinki route, three departures on Helsinki-Gdynia and Gdynia-Travemünde routes&lt;/b&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;On 2 June, Finnlines is to open two new fast, reliable and comfortable Motorways of the Sea for cargo and passengers in the Baltic, between Finland and Poland (Helsinki-Gdynia) and between Poland and Germany (Gdynia- Travemünde), featuring three sailings per week each. At the same time Travemünde-Helsinki-sailings are increased from nine to ten per week. &l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;All of the departures on the Travemünde- Helsinki; Helsinki-Gdynia and Gdynia- Travemünde routes are operated by the world’s largest Ro-ro passenger ferries in terms of cargo capacity: the five “Star Class” sisterships, all of them built in 2006 and 2007. Each of these huge units can carry up to 4,200 lane metres of trailers, lorries, busses and cars while transporting in the maximum comfort and leisure to 500 passengers in 200 cabins.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;Faster and safer&lt;/b&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;The crossing between Finland and Poland is takes only 19 hours, while the direct connection from Helsinki to Travemünde is completed in in 27 hours. As for the Gdynia- Travemünde, the first Motorway of the Sea between Germany and Poland: the route is completed in 15 hours. &l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;From more information on timetables and reservation, please click &lt;a href="/index.php/passenger_eng/misc/gdynia_route_opens_02_06_2009" target="_self"&gt;here&lt;/a&gt;.&lt;/p&gt;</description>
